In addition to recording and searching instant noodles data, this index value also plays the role of recording date information, and the amount of information is considerable.
So, how to restore the index value to available date information?
date('z') returns the day of the year, and the return value is an integer starting from 0 to 365. To restore these integers to date information, we just need a simple calculation. Taking the 159th day of this year (2008) (actually 160 days, starting from 0 in PHP, 0 corresponds to the regular first day) as an example, the method for calculating its date and week is as follows:

Copy code The code is as follows:


$MyDate=159; //Day 159
$milliseconds = mktime(0,0,0,1,1,2008) + $MyDate * 86400; //Get UNIX time Stamp
$msg = date('F jS Y , l',$milliseconds); //Format date output
echo $msg;
?>


Run the above program, the information displayed on the browser will be: June 8th 2008, Sunday
Explanation:
One. $milliseconds is a UNIX timestamp variable, which indicates the number of milliseconds since the UNIX era (January 1, 1700) experienced on the 159th day of 2008, which will be used as a parameter It is used in the date() function to participate in calculating date information and is an important basis. To correctly calculate the value of $milliseconds, we first need to get the number of milliseconds experienced on January 1, 2008, that is, mktime(0,0,0,1,1,2008), and then add the number of milliseconds in 159 days, That is, $MyDate * 86400, since there are 86400 milliseconds in each day.
2. $msg is the date information we format and output. The value of this variable is obtained through the date() function. The first parameter "'F jS Y, l'" is just the formatting format. It can also be set to something else as needed. , the second parameter is the number of milliseconds (long integer), which means the total number of milliseconds that have elapsed from the beginning of UNIX to a specific moment.
In order to verify the correctness of the program, we can print the number of milliseconds experienced on June 8, 2008: mktime(0,0,0,6,8,2008), its value will be the same as $milliseconds: 1212854400.
